full of beans vs high-energy

full of beans

adj
  • Energetic and enthusiastic. 

  • Incorrect; uninformed; exaggerating or expressing falsehood. 

high-energy

adj
  • Vigorous, energetic, or dynamic. 

  • Producing a large amount of energy when reacting. 

  • Having an energy greater than 100,000 electron volts.
